Abstract

In an intravenous needle and needle holder assembly, the needle is attached to an inner case, through which intravenous fluid is supplied, by a length of flexible tubing. An outer case is provided which surrounds the tubing during insertion of the needle into a patient's vein, so as to rigidify the needle during such insertion. After insertion, the outer case can be removed from at least a part of the flexible tubing so that the tubing provides a flexible connection between the inner case and the needle useful during administration of intravenous fluid.
